Mail truck caught fire on Van Phong-Nha Trang highway

On the afternoon of November 13, a mail truck suddenly caught fire while traveling on the Van Phong-Nha Trang highway (section passing through Dien Lam commune, Khanh Hoa province).

At about 4:10 p.m. at the above location, a truck with license plate 50H-xxx (belonging to a company in Ho Chi Minh City) driven by driver NNT (35 years old, residing in Dak Lak ), traveling from South to North, suddenly caught fire.

Seeing black smoke coming from the truck, the driver immediately pulled into the emergency lane and left the cabin before the fire engulfed the entire cargo.

Authorities quickly arrived at the scene to extinguish the fire. Photo: Fire Prevention and Rescue Police Department, Khanh Hoa Provincial Police

Upon receiving the news, the Fire Prevention and Rescue Police Department of Khanh Hoa Province mobilized forces and specialized vehicles to put out the fire. The Traffic Police (under the Ministry of Public Security ) quickly blocked and diverted traffic through the area.

The fire burned most of the goods on the truck. Photo: Fire Prevention and Rescue Police Department, Khanh Hoa Provincial Police

After several minutes of high-pressure water spraying, the fire was brought under control. The driver was uninjured, but most of the cargo, including letters, newspapers, and printed documents, was burned; the front and cabin of the vehicle were slightly smoke-damaged.

Currently, the police are coordinating with relevant units to examine the scene and clarify the cause of the incident.
